Homemade Clackulator

Craft & Design
Homemade Clackulator

M39-clackulator-front

When you think “pocket calculator,” your next thought probably isn’t “custom cabinetry.” But for Simon Winder in Seattle, his single-operation relay calculating engine, built over five years, with over eight months of full-time work, deserved nothing less. The cabinet was built by local artisan Matthew Richter.

“You can easily see how these devices [electromechanical relays] are being used, in contrast to modern computers where the operations happen far removed from human senses,” muses Winder.

M39-clackulator-Simon-WinderThe machine has one function: to calculate and display a square root. The user enters a number on a rotary dial, whose pulses are stored in binary by the system of relays. The start button activates a mechanical clock pulse generator that triggers every operation state with precision timing.

A full calculation takes about a minute. While the operations cascade through 480 relay switches, hand-wired into circuits, each closing relay declares itself by lighting up with a satisfying mechanical clack. A bell announces completion of the final calculation, and the answer displays on eight nixie tubes.

Winder will be bringing his fantastic contraption to Maker Faire Bay Area 2014.

For more, visit simonwinder.com/projects/relay-calculating-engine.

This slideshow requires JavaScript.

What will the next generation of Make: look like? We’re inviting you to shape the future by investing in Make:. By becoming an investor, you help decide what’s next. The future of Make: is in your hands. Learn More.

Tagged

Gregory Hayes is a helpful being who has lots of fun. He makes most of his living as a photographer and writer, and occasionally tweets @mootpointblank.

View more articles by Gregory Hayes
Discuss this article with the rest of the community on our Discord server!

ADVERTISEMENT

Escape to an island of imagination + innovation as Maker Faire Bay Area returns for its 16th iteration!

Prices Increase in....

Days
Hours
Minutes
Seconds
FEEDBACK